The product A formed in the following reaction is:
Diazotization and Sandmeyer Reaction diagram for Q71 - JEE Main 2024 Evening
The diagram details aniline undergoing diazotization with sodium nitrite and hydrochloric acid, followed by treatment with cuprous chloride.

Solution & Explanation

### Related Formula textAr-NH_2 xrightarrowtextNaNO_2 + textHCl, 0^circtextC textAr-N_2^+textCl^- xrightarrowtextCu_2textCl_2 textAr-Cl ### Core Logic The schematic outlines a classic sequence: 1. **Diazotization Step**: Aniline reacts with nitrous acid generated in situ (textNaNO_2 + textHCl) at low temperature (0-5^circtextC) to form benzene diazonium chloride intermediate. 2. **Sandmeyer Replacement Step**: Treating the diazonium salt with cuprous chloride (textCu_2textCl_2) results in replacement of the diazo group by a chlorine atom. ### Step 1: Visual Verification Tracing structural shifts through intermediates validates the final outcome:
